RPG Asdivine Menace is a Roleplaying/Adventure game from Kotobuki Solution Co., Ltd., first launched in 2nd February 2016.
It’s rated 9+ and currently has 200+ ratings on the App Store.

    A century after the events of Asdivine Dios peace has finally settled in. That is, until a visitor from another world suddenly shows up proclaiming the entire universe is about to be destroyed.

Hearing this, Izayoi sets off in an attempt to reverse this seemingly pronounced fate with a trio of very idiosyncratic spirits as they criss-cross four worlds in search of an answer. But what is the answer they find…?

We thoroughly enjoyed another Asdivine game, Asdivine Dios, so we gave this a try. More of the same stuff which is by no means bad. The plot is pretty simple but enjoyable. You are a somewhat oblivious but super-benevolent male deity, surrounded by a bunch of female spirits who all end up gushing a little over how cool you are. Somehow, the game pulls it off and this actually feels charming. Antics ensue as you try to save… It looks like a bunch of different worlds, this time. The combat system is standard but has some clever mechanics. If you liked the battles in something like FF6 you'll like them here. Most importantly there's a good sense of your characters growing in power… After you get past the first few battles, which feel unnecessarily hard. Highly recommended as a great little free RPG you might sink quite a few hours into. Unlike most mobile RPGs this is actually a game to play. It's free and with no way walls. The story is alright if a bit cliche. Combat is turn based where characters use either mundane attacks, Item, Magic, and Skills. There is a "cash shop" we're you can but powerful endgame items; however, the currency you use to buy these items can be earned as very rare item drops . All in all this is a great game worth your time, especially if your a JRPG fan. One last note this game dose have adds with a pay option to remove them (it's $5) it also gives you some premium currency. It's worth it if you want to support the game developers.
